| 3.8 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 7/10 | 3/5 | 8/10 | 4/5 | 16/20 | Feb 14, 2009 On draft, pours pretty dark brown, hazy. Weizen aroma, more clove than banana. Flavor is pretty cool, has a nice aftertaste of chocolate. Medium to low mouthfeel. Alcohol was 7% abv. 3Faveryrogue (105), Aslip, Illinois, USA
